When you go to a pet shop, it is vital to evaluate the health of the parrot you desire. Healthy parrots display certain physical signs, consisting of:
Bright Eyes: Clear and brilliant eyes are an excellent indicator of health. Enjoy for any discharge or cloudiness.Tidy Feathers: The feathers must appear smooth and tidy. Look out for signs of excessive molting or plume loss.Active Behavior: A healthy parrot will be active, curious, and engaged with its environment. Expect any indications of lethargy.No Breathing Issues: Listen for regular breathing sounds. Wheezing or labored breathing can suggest breathing concerns.Balanced Weight: The bird should have a healthy weight; protruding breast bones might suggest malnourishment.Essential Considerations Before Purchase1. Research study and Education
Before making a purchase, it's important to inform yourself on the specific needs of the parrot species you have an interest in. Understand their dietary needs, social requirements, and space factors to consider. Various parrots have distinct characters, which can influence how they connect with their owners and other animals.
2. Long-Term Commitment
Parrots are not just pets; they are long-lasting buddies. Some types can live for over 50 years, so be gotten ready for a long-term commitment. Consider your way of life and whether you can supply the care, attention, and social interaction a parrot needs.
3. Financial Responsibility
Owning a parrot includes ongoing costs, consisting of food, cage purchase and maintenance, toys, and veterinary care. Create a budget plan to represent all possible costs.
4. Socialization
Parrots are social animals and thrive on interaction with people and other birds. Think about whether you will have the time to engage daily with your parrot, as disregard can lead to behavioral problems.

3. Diet
A well balanced diet is important for a parrot's health. Research study the particular dietary requirements of your picked species. A lot of parrots need a mix of pellets, fresh fruits, and vegetables.

A1: Yes, however you need to select a smaller species, such as a budgie or cockatiel. Guarantee you supply adequate out-of-cage time for workout and socializing.
Q2: Do parrots actually require companions?
A2: Yes, most parrot types are social and prosper on interaction. If you're hectic, consider adopting 2 birds to keep each other company.

Q4: Are parrots loud?
A4: Yes, many parrots can be rather singing, particularly bigger types. Research the noise level associated with the species you're interested in.
Q5: How often should I take my parrot to the veterinarian?
A5: Routine vet check-ups are important. Preferably, take your parrot for a check-up a minimum of once a year, or more regularly if health problems emerge.
